Osogbo Progressive Union Swears In New Leadership, Pledges Unity And Revival Of Oroki Day

According to Ireporter Online, the Osogbo Progressive Union (OPU), the umbrella organization representing all indigenes of Osogbo, Osun State, has inaugurated its new executive team.

Alhaji Abdul Lateef Olayanju was sworn in as the President of OPU, alongside other executive members, during a ceremony held at the Ataoja Palace in Osogbo on Saturday.

In his acceptance address, Olayanju emphasized the leadership’s commitment to uniting all indigenes and reviving the annual Oroki Day, a traditional gathering that last took place in 2014. He stated that the union would work closely with the Osogbo Elders’ Council and the Osogbo Action Council to ensure the celebration returns in 2026.

Olayanju urged all indigenes to participate actively in programs that promote the welfare and image of Osogbo, describing Oroki Day as a key initiative for fostering community cohesion.
